A Cedar Falls man has been arrested on multiple charges after allegedly assaulting his girlfriend.

James Gilliam Jr. III was taken into custody Wednesday night after the victim arrived at the Cedar Falls Public Safety Center and reported that she had been assaulted by him at the home they shared. Authorities said the woman had multiple injuries.

The 39-year-old Gilliam was taken into custody a short time later. According to public safety officials, Gilliam resisted his arrest and assaulted officers during the incident.

Gilliam was charged with the following offenses:

  • Domestic assault impeding air/blood flow causing bodily injury (Class D felony)
  • Assault on a Peace Officer Causing Bodily Injury (aggravated misdemeanor)
  • Assault on a Peace Officer (serious misdemeanor)
  • Interference with official acts causing bodily injury (aggravated misdemeanor)

Gilliam was booked into the Black Hawk County Jail on the four charges.
